Removing the Optical Drive from the Drive Tray
1Remove the interposer board from the drive by deflecting the tab at each end of the board.
2To remove the drive from the tray, push outward on the left retention tab at the back of the tray so as to bend the tray wall out slightly and then pull up on the left side of the drive to disengage.
To install a new drive in the tray, fit the drive into the tray, then fit the interposer board onto the back of the drive.
